#if !DEVICE_WATCHDOG
 | 
						|
#error [NOT_SUPPORTED] Watchdog not supported for this target
 | 
						|
#elif !COMPONENT_FPGA_CI_TEST_SHIELD
 | 
						|
#error [NOT_SUPPORTED] FPGA CI Test Shield is needed to run this test
 | 
						|
#elif !defined(TARGET_FF_ARDUINO) && !defined(MBED_CONF_TARGET_DEFAULT_FORM_FACTOR)
 | 
						|
#error [NOT_SUPPORTED] Test not supported for this form factor
 | 
						|
#else
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#include "utest/utest.h"
 | 
						|
#include "unity/unity.h"
 | 
						|
#include "greentea-client/test_env.h"
 | 
						|
#include "mbed.h"
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#include "MbedTester.h"
 | 
						|
#include "test_utils.h"
 | 
						|
#include "hal/watchdog_api.h"
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#define MSG_VALUE_DUMMY "0"
 | 
						|
#define CASE_DATA_INVALID 0xffffffffUL
 | 
						|
#define CASE_DATA_PHASE2_OK 0xfffffffeUL
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#define MSG_VALUE_LEN 24
 | 
						|
#define MSG_KEY_LEN 24
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#define MSG_KEY_DEVICE_READY "ready"
 | 
						|
#define MSG_KEY_START_CASE "start_case"
 | 
						|
#define MSG_KEY_DEVICE_RESET "dev_reset"
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#define WATCHDOG_PULSE_PERIOD_US 1000
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
using utest::v1::Case;
 | 
						|
using utest::v1::Specification;
 | 
						|
using utest::v1::Harness;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
struct testcase_data {
 | 
						|
    int index;
 | 
						|
    int start_index;
 | 
						|
    uint32_t received_data;
 | 
						|
};
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
testcase_data current_case;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
/**
 | 
						|
 * Get the first pin from the whitelist that is absent form the blacklist.
 | 
						|
 *
 | 
						|
 * @param whitelist List of pins to choose from
 | 
						|
 * @param blacklist List of pins which cannot be used
 | 
						|
 * @return The first pin from the whitelist absent from the blacklist.
 | 
						|
 */
 | 
						|
PinName get_pin_to_restrict(const PinList *whitelist, const PinList *blacklist)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    for (uint32_t i = 0; i < whitelist->count; i++) {
 | 
						|
        if (!pinmap_list_has_pin(blacklist, whitelist->pins[i])) {
 | 
						|
            return whitelist->pins[i];
 | 
						|
        }
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
    return NC;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
/**
 | 
						|
 * Allocate a new PinList, copy the pin_list and add the pin at the end.
 | 
						|
 *
 | 
						|
 * @param pin_list List of pins to copy
 | 
						|
 * @param pin The pin to add at the end of the new PinList
 | 
						|
 * @return Pointer to the allocated PinList or NULL on error.
 | 
						|
 */
 | 
						|
PinList *alloc_extended_pinlist(const PinList *pin_list, PinName pin)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    PinName *pins = (PinName *) calloc(pin_list->count + 1, sizeof(PinName));
 | 
						|
    if (pins == NULL) {
 | 
						|
        return NULL;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
    for (uint32_t i = 0; i < pin_list->count; i++) {
 | 
						|
        pins[i] = pin_list->pins[i];
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
    pins[pin_list->count] = pin;
 | 
						|
    PinList *new_pinlist = (PinList *) calloc(1, sizeof(PinList));
 | 
						|
    if (new_pinlist == NULL) {
 | 
						|
        free(pins);
 | 
						|
        return NULL;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
    new_pinlist->count = pin_list->count + 1;
 | 
						|
    new_pinlist->pins = pins;
 | 
						|
    return new_pinlist;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
/**
 | 
						|
 * Free a previously allocated PinList.
 | 
						|
 *
 | 
						|
 * @param pin_list List of pins to free.
 | 
						|
 */
 | 
						|
void free_pinlist(PinList *pin_list)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    if (pin_list) {
 | 
						|
        if (pin_list->pins) {
 | 
						|
            free((PinName *) pin_list->pins);
 | 
						|
        }
 | 
						|
        free(pin_list);
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
bool send_reset_notification(testcase_data *tcdata, uint32_t delay_ms)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    char msg_value[12];
 | 
						|
    int str_len = snprintf(msg_value, sizeof msg_value, "%02x,%08lx", tcdata->start_index + tcdata->index, delay_ms);
 | 
						|
    if (str_len < 0) {
 | 
						|
        utest_printf("Failed to compose a value string to be sent to host.");
 | 
						|
        return false;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
    greentea_send_kv(MSG_KEY_DEVICE_RESET, msg_value);
 | 
						|
    return true;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
template<uint32_t timeout_ms>
 | 
						|
void fpga_test_watchdog_timeout_accuracy()
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    watchdog_features_t features = hal_watchdog_get_platform_features();
 | 
						|
    if (timeout_ms > features.max_timeout) {
 | 
						|
        TEST_IGNORE_MESSAGE("Requested timeout value not supported for this target -- ignoring test case.");
 | 
						|
        return;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    PinName watchdog_pulse_pin = get_pin_to_restrict(DefaultFormFactor::pins(), DefaultFormFactor::restricted_pins());
 | 
						|
    TEST_ASSERT(watchdog_pulse_pin != NC);
 | 
						|
    PinList *blacklist = alloc_extended_pinlist(DefaultFormFactor::restricted_pins(), watchdog_pulse_pin);
 | 
						|
    TEST_ASSERT_NOT_NULL(blacklist);
 | 
						|
    MbedTester tester(DefaultFormFactor::pins(), blacklist);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    // Phase 2. -- verify the test results.
 | 
						|
    // Verify the FPGA time measurement is within given range:
 | 
						|
    // 1. The watchdog should trigger at, or after the timeout value.
 | 
						|
    // 2. The watchdog should trigger before twice the timeout value.
 | 
						|
    if (current_case.received_data != CASE_DATA_INVALID) {
 | 
						|
        TEST_ASSERT_EQUAL(CASE_DATA_PHASE2_OK, current_case.received_data);
 | 
						|
        current_case.received_data = CASE_DATA_INVALID;
 | 
						|
        tester.io_metrics_stop();
 | 
						|
        uint32_t num_falling_edges = tester.io_metrics_falling_edges(MbedTester::LogicalPinIOMetrics0);
 | 
						|
        uint32_t actual_timeout_ms = 0;
 | 
						|
        if (num_falling_edges > 0) {
 | 
						|
            actual_timeout_ms = (num_falling_edges - 1) * WATCHDOG_PULSE_PERIOD_US / 1000;
 | 
						|
        }
 | 
						|
        utest_printf("The FPGA shield measured %lu ms timeout.", actual_timeout_ms);
 | 
						|
        TEST_ASSERT(actual_timeout_ms >= timeout_ms);
 | 
						|
        TEST_ASSERT(actual_timeout_ms < 2 * timeout_ms);
 | 
						|
        free_pinlist(blacklist);
 | 
						|
        return;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    // Phase 1. -- run the test code.
 | 
						|
    tester.reset();
 | 
						|
    tester.pin_map_set(watchdog_pulse_pin, MbedTester::LogicalPinIOMetrics0);
 | 
						|
    gpio_t pulse_pin;
 | 
						|
    int pulse_pin_value = 1;
 | 
						|
    gpio_init_out_ex(&pulse_pin, watchdog_pulse_pin, pulse_pin_value);
 | 
						|
    // Init the watchdog and wait for a device reset.
 | 
						|
    watchdog_config_t config = { timeout_ms };
 | 
						|
    if (send_reset_notification(¤t_case, 2 * timeout_ms) == false) {
 | 
						|
        TEST_ASSERT_MESSAGE(0, "Dev-host communication error.");
 | 
						|
        free_pinlist(blacklist);
 | 
						|
        return;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
    tester.io_metrics_start();
 | 
						|
    TEST_ASSERT_EQUAL(WATCHDOG_STATUS_OK, hal_watchdog_init(&config));
 | 
						|
    while (1) {
 | 
						|
        pulse_pin_value ^= 1;
 | 
						|
        gpio_write(&pulse_pin, pulse_pin_value);
 | 
						|
        wait_us(WATCHDOG_PULSE_PERIOD_US / 2);
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
utest::v1::status_t case_setup(const Case *const source, const size_t index_of_case)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    current_case.index = index_of_case;
 | 
						|
    return utest::v1::greentea_case_setup_handler(source, index_of_case);
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
int testsuite_setup(const size_t number_of_cases)
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    GREENTEA_SETUP(90, "watchdog_reset");
 | 
						|
    utest::v1::status_t status = utest::v1::greentea_test_setup_handler(number_of_cases);
 | 
						|
    if (status != utest::v1::STATUS_CONTINUE) {
 | 
						|
        return status;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    char key[MSG_KEY_LEN + 1] = { };
 | 
						|
    char value[MSG_VALUE_LEN + 1] = { };
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    greentea_send_kv(MSG_KEY_DEVICE_READY, MSG_VALUE_DUMMY);
 | 
						|
    greentea_parse_kv(key, value, MSG_KEY_LEN, MSG_VALUE_LEN);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    if (strcmp(key, MSG_KEY_START_CASE) != 0) {
 | 
						|
        utest_printf("Invalid message key.\n");
 | 
						|
        return utest::v1::STATUS_ABORT;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    int num_args = sscanf(value, "%02x,%08lx", &(current_case.start_index), &(current_case.received_data));
 | 
						|
    if (num_args == 0 || num_args == EOF) {
 | 
						|
        utest_printf("Invalid data received from host\n");
 | 
						|
        return utest::v1::STATUS_ABORT;
 | 
						|
    }
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    utest_printf("This test suite is composed of %i test cases. Starting at index %i.\n", number_of_cases,
 | 
						|
                 current_case.start_index);
 | 
						|
    return current_case.start_index;
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
Case cases[] = {
 | 
						|
    Case("Timeout accuracy,  200 ms", case_setup, fpga_test_watchdog_timeout_accuracy<200UL>),
 | 
						|
    Case("Timeout accuracy,  500 ms", case_setup, fpga_test_watchdog_timeout_accuracy<500UL>),
 | 
						|
    Case("Timeout accuracy, 1000 ms", case_setup, fpga_test_watchdog_timeout_accuracy<1000UL>),
 | 
						|
    Case("Timeout accuracy, 3000 ms", case_setup, fpga_test_watchdog_timeout_accuracy<3000UL>),
 | 
						|
};
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
Specification specification((utest::v1::test_setup_handler_t) testsuite_setup, cases);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
int main()
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
    // Harness will start with a test case index provided by host script.
 | 
						|
    return !Harness::run(specification);
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
#endif // !DEVICE_WATCHDOG
